5. A 0.065 kg tennis ball moving to the right with a speed of 15 m/s is struck by a racket, causing it to move to the left with a speed of 15 m/s. If the ball remained in contact with the racket for 0:020 seconds, what is the magnitude of the average force exerted on the ball? A. zero B. 98 N C. 160 N D. 160000 N E. 98000 N
